Pros: Good story, nice-looking hospital, mouselook, jumping

Cons: There was a glitch in the hospital which prevented me from playing.

great game...

OK, I hate to be mean, but the first thing I look for in a game is whether or not it drags me in. I first notice that there is no menu, just some video playing, and when I click I start. The graphics are quite bland, and it's very easy to get lost (or bored) due to the lack of landmarks and variety. I don't even know what I'm supposed to do, so I go out and kill people. Anyway, I beat the first level and for some reason get taken to a hospital. I have no idea what to do (and for some reason, the sky is a foot above me), so I talk to the nurse. She's looking for some guy. I find him, and then I can't move. I'm stuck. I had to quit the game.

What I *did* like, however, was the integration of the mouse and the jumping capabilities. That made the experience more fun. I also enjoyed the dialogue and story (although it made little sense).

All in all, not a terrible game, but the flaws keep me from enjoying it.
